A circle has a diameter of 12 units, and its center has been translated 4 units
up and 9 units to the left from the origin. What is the equation of the circle?

The equation of the circle is (x + 9)² + (y - 4)² = 36

Radius of circle

Since the circle has a diameter, d = 12 units, its radius, r = d/2 = 12/2

= 6 units.

Coordinates of center of circle

Now, since its center translated 4 units up and 9 units to the left from the origin.

It means that the y-ccordinate for its center is (0 + 4) = 4 and the x -coordinate for its center is (0 - 9) = -9

So, the center of this circle is at (-9,4)

Equation of a circle.

The equation of a circle with center (h,k) is given by

(x - h)² + (y - k)² = r² where r = radius of circle.

For our given circle,

  • (h, k) = (-9, 4) and
  • r = 6.

So, substituting the values of the variables into the equation, we have

(x - h)² + (y - k)² = r²

(x - (-9))² + (y - 4)² = 6²

(x + 9)² + (y - 4)² = 36

So, the equation of the circle is (x + 9)² + (y - 4)² = 36
